This was one of our absolute favourite moments in our chat with the irrepressible Héctor Bellerín, a football player with Real Betis - how and what you choose to value. Does a good day at work make you more valuable? Are you less valuable if you’re having a tough time?
If we view through the world through a binary lens - good/bad, right/wrong, win/lose - we miss the details, the nuances, the lessons we can use over the long term pursuit of high performance on our own terms.

In this episode, Héctor Bellerín, a renowned footballer, delves into the concept of self-worth and its relation to performance in the realm of football. He emphasizes the importance of maintaining a stable sense of self-worth, regardless of external factors such as wins or losses. Bellerín highlights the binary nature of football, where success and failure are often seen as polar opposites, leading to emotional highs and lows.
Bellerín contrasts this with the contentment experienced by individuals who appreciate the simple joys of life, such as a good cup of coffee or spending time with loved ones. He expresses his admiration for those who can find happiness in the mundane, acknowledging that he himself is striving to become more appreciative of life's little moments.
Bellerín acknowledges that the way children are raised in the competitive world of football can be detrimental to their long-term well-being. He suggests that this environment, with its emphasis on performance-based self-worth, can lead to unhealthy outcomes as they grow older.

[02:22.360 -> 02:26.060] As a human, I would say the analogy of like a candle,
[02:26.060 -> 02:27.760] you know, it should always be like a candle.
[02:27.760 -> 02:30.740] That's always burning at the same rate, right?
[02:30.740 -> 02:32.840] So your value is always this.
[02:32.840 -> 02:34.240] So it doesn't matter if you score a goal,
[02:34.240 -> 02:35.840] it doesn't matter if you score an own goal,
[02:35.840 -> 02:37.060] it doesn't matter if you lose, you always win.
[02:37.060 -> 02:38.520] Your value is always here.
[02:38.520 -> 02:40.940] In football is always a complete other way around.
[02:40.940 -> 02:43.480] It's like you score a goal, you win a trophy, boom,
[02:43.480 -> 02:44.940] but then you lose and you're down here.
[02:44.940 -> 02:46.400] So you never in the middle and everything a trophy, boom. But then you lose and you're down here. So you're never in the middle.
[02:46.400 -> 02:49.160] And everything around you, all the voices around you,
[02:49.160 -> 02:51.500] your coach doesn't pick you if you don't play well.
[02:51.500 -> 02:55.060] The media doesn't talk good about you,
[02:55.060 -> 02:56.400] but it's not that they don't talk good about you,
[02:56.400 -> 02:57.440] they talk bad.
[02:57.440 -> 02:59.320] So they dig you a hole, you know?
[02:59.320 -> 03:01.440] And then some of people that you call friends,
[03:01.440 -> 03:02.440] maybe you're not playing that well,
[03:02.440 -> 03:04.480] but they don't talk to you as much.
[03:04.480 -> 03:05.840] But then when you do well again
[03:05.840 -> 03:08.880] everyone is messaging you every week, and oh what a great game you played
[03:08.880 -> 03:12.000] everyone on Instagram, so the can do is constantly like this. So you're being
[03:12.000 -> 03:14.800] defined by what happens on a football field? Yeah, basically your self-esteem is
[03:14.800 -> 03:17.360] like performance self-esteem, it's not like
[03:17.360 -> 03:20.640] your value is dictated by your performance, which
[03:20.640 -> 03:25.440] not healthy human beings can be happy with those metrics.
[03:25.440 -> 03:27.880] But then you have to hate losing and love winning
[03:27.880 -> 03:28.720] to then be calm.
[03:28.720 -> 03:30.480] But then I feel like when that candle
[03:30.480 -> 03:31.680] is always burning so hard,
[03:31.680 -> 03:34.000] then it's so easy to get blown out at the same time.
[03:34.000 -> 03:37.320] So it's always constantly highs and lows, highs and lows.
[03:37.320 -> 03:40.160] Whereas I feel like a lot of people that are happy
[03:40.160 -> 03:42.440] are people that sometimes like they just work their nine
[03:42.440 -> 03:44.640] to five, they have their family,
[03:44.640 -> 03:48.720] their life is always somehow in like the same way and like they appreciate things that,
[03:49.520 -> 03:53.840] just simple things, they appreciate waking up in the morning and they taste the coffee and you know
[03:53.840 -> 03:58.800] how far this coffee's come from and who's made, you know, there's so many like enjoying the-
[03:58.800 -> 04:02.720] I relate, I feel jealous of people like that, don't you? I see them and I think I wish I could feel-
[04:02.720 -> 04:07.200] And I feel like I'm trying to become more that and I'm trying to be enjoying more the little
[04:07.200 -> 04:11.360] things and the simple things in life and I think quarantine that's been so great for so many people
[04:11.360 -> 04:15.360] because even just spending time with the kids at home when they were working in the office every
[04:15.360 -> 04:20.320] single day of the week and things like that and to me it's made me appreciate more the sunset and
[04:20.320 -> 04:25.320] where I live I can't even see the stars where but I couldn't see them in London. And it's been great, you know, having those little moments,
[04:25.320 -> 04:29.320] but I think the way that we raise kids playing
[04:29.320 -> 04:31.560] in this kind of game,
[04:31.560 -> 04:34.860] it's not healthy for them when they become older.
